Apollo Commercial Real Estate Finance Inc. highlights $8.3B global loan portfolio and 10.1% dividend yield in new investor presentation

Apollo Commercial Real Estate Finance Inc. $(ARI)$ has released an investor presentation detailing its recent portfolio and platform developments. As of September 30, 2025, the company reported a portfolio carrying value of $8.3 billion across 54 loans, with 98% of its portfolio in first mortgage positions and a weighted average loan-to-value ratio of 57%. The presentation notes a weighted average remaining fully-extended loan term of three years and a portfolio risk rating of 3.0. Since 2009, Apollo has deployed $28 billion in capital, with $16 billion in global loan originations for 2024 and over $72 billion in global assets under management. The company maintains relationships with a range of real estate sponsors and operators across the United States, United Kingdom, and Western Europe.
